Transaction 6961544040702a02d767fb43a71d8c91d409168954a6afee4012fb0566793ead
1 Input
1 Output
-
6961544040702a02d767fb43a71d8c91d409168954a6afee4012fb0566793ead:0
- value
- 150170
- script pubkey
- OP_0 OP_PUSHBYTES_20 aebd427ab69872427db0cb3e6ee6c8d098b32788
- address
- bc1q4675y74knpeyyldsevlxaekg6zvtxfugfp5psp